After five and a half years in the USA, Tim is back in Alberta and has just finished recording his sophomore project in Three Hills with producer Mark Troyer at Muzik Haus studio.
Tim will be continuing in a new ministry he's starting aimed at helping raise the bar in worship in local churches all across North America. With the release of his new book, "For the Renown of His Name," Tim will be doing worship workshops, worship consulting for churches and teaching, in addition to leading worship and continuing to create music.
The First single from the album is Greater Grace and is currently being played on stations all across Canada.

I have had the privilege to meet and worship with Canada's Tim Milner and he truly has a passion for praising our God. Kiss The Son is Tim's 2nd album and a great follow-up to Form And Essence. Right from the opening song O Worship The King, a hymn re-write with a new chorus similar to Chris Tomlin's version from Passion's Hymns album, Tim brings uplifting reverence and joy of worship to our King. The title song brings scripture to life and is based on Psalm 2: "Kiss The Son, lest He be angry" and Revelation 19:11-16.
The other highlights for me are Extol, Greater Grace-the first single released in Canada, For Such A Time and Follow, a great rocking song of praise to our God. The album ends like it starts, with a nice hymn re-write of This Is My Father's World with Tim's wife Dorilee singing lead. I really enjoy the vibe of this album and the melodies and lyrics are all solid and biblical. Fans of Lincoln Brewster or Chris Tomlin should enjoy this solid worship album.
